The First Humanoid Robot Astronaut | Jim Hudson Toyota

Fitted with Toyota’s latest voice-recognition technology, Kirobo, the robot astronaut, will travel to the International Space Station where it will begin to help bridge the gap between technology and humanity.

IRMO, S.C. - Aug. 12, 2013 - PRLog -- Irmo, South Carolina—Kirobo — derived from the Japanese words for "hope" and "robot" — was among five tons of supplies and machinery launched Sunday for the International Space Station from Tanegashima, southwestern Japan.

“The childlike robot was designed to be a companion for astronaut Koichi Wakata, and will communicate with another robot on Earth, according to developers,” said the Japanese Aerospace Exploration Agency (JAXA). Wakata is expected to arrive at the space station in November.

Robot designer Tomotaka Takahashi, of the University of Tokyo, advertiser Dentsu and automaker Toyota Motor Corp. worked on the robot. The challenge was making sure it could talk and move properly in a zero-g environment.

Prior to the launch, the 13-inch tall Kirobo told reporters, "one small step for me, a giant leap for robots.”

Although Japan boasts the most sophisticated robotics in the world, it has often been criticized for not being productive due to its “manga” culture which leads the industry to favor cute robots with human-like characteristics and emotional appeal. But Takahashi, the designer, said sending a robot into space could help write a new chapter in the history of communication.

"I wish for this robot to function as a mediator between person and machine, or person and Internet and sometimes even between people," he said. JAXA, Japan's equivalent of NASA, said the rocket launch was successful, and the separation of a cargo vehicle, carrying the robot to the space station, was confirmed about 15 minutes after liftoff.
